Ph. Benet is a scholar working on Nuclear and High Energy Physics, Atomic and Molecular Physics, and Optics and Radiation. According to data from OpenAlex, Ph. Benet has authored 30 papers receiving a total of 928 ind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Nuclear and High Energy Physics, 16 papers in Atomic and Molecular Physics, and Optics and 9 papers in Radiation. Recurrent topics in Ph. Benet’s work include Nuclear physics research studies (28 papers), Atomic and Molecular Physics (11 papers) and Astronomical and nuclear sciences (9 papers). Ph. Benet is often cited by papers focused on Nuclear physics research studies (28 papers), Atomic and Molecular Physics (11 papers) and Astronomical and nuclear sciences (9 papers). Ph. Benet collaborates with scholars based in United States, United Kingdom and Argentina. Ph. Benet's co-authors include E. F. Moore, R. V. F. Janssens, I. Ahmad, M. P. Carpenter, D. Ye, T. L. Khoo, M. W. Drigert, U. Garg, F. L. H. Wolfs and K. Beard and has published in prestigious journals such as Physical Review Letters, Physics Letters B and Nuclear Physics A.
